This article describes how to change your Microsoft Outlook 98 installation
from "Internet Mail Only" to "Corporate Workgroup" and from Corporate
Workgroup to Internet Mail Only.
MORE INFORMATION
Conversion from Internet Mail Only (IMO)to Corporate Workgroup (CW)
requires that you run the Outlook 98 setup program in Maintenance mode.
The steps to change from one type of installation to the other are similar
except for the installation option you choose.
NOTE: When you switch from the Internet Mail Only to the Corporate Workgroup installation of Outlook, the information that was contained in your old Internet Messaging Access Protocol (IMAP) account is not transferred to your new installation. It is important to also note that you should only switch to another
installation type once. Switching back and forth can cause certain user
options to be lost.
